Anti-theft System Renault cars are fitted with various anti-theft systems. Some have keys that are only usable by the original owner, while others have a transponder system to prevent theft. The transponder system sends an alert to the car's computer whenever it is near to the ignition switch. If the signal matches with the one stored in the computer, the engine will begin. If not, the car won't start and an error message will show on the dashboard. The problem with these systems is that they can stop working if the chip inside the key becomes damaged. This is often caused by a knock or wear and tear, which is why it is crucial to contact a locksmith as soon as you notice any issues. Transponder keys Transponder keys are a standard feature in most newer automobiles. This type of key does not require batteries and relies on radio waves to activate a microchip on the immobilizer. The immobilizer checks the digital fingerprint, and removes the key in the event that it matches. This stops the car from being started by anyone else who might have access to the keys. Certain manufacturers make it difficult to create additional keys, so it is important to know your car's immobilizer system prior to attempting this task. Certain models have a exclusive technology that allows dealers to make an alternative key, whereas others require special tools and software to complete this task. The RR021 device from Abrites Diagnostics for Renault/ Dacia includes key programming functions for all key additions and ALL KEYS LOST situations for the Master III and Kangoo II models of the vehicle. This device is compatible with the AVDI Interface and active AMS.
